Butterfly Network looks to streamline the ultrasound workflow and disrupt the incumbent market with its portable ultrasound technology that uses semiconductors instead of traditional crystals, CEO Joe DeVivo explains to Bloomberg Intelligence. In this Vanguards of Health Care podcast episode, DeVivo sits down with BI analyst Matt Henriksson to talk about Butterfly's new iQ3 system that employs computer chips from TSMC (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co.) to match the quality of traditional ultrasound, all in the palm of a physician's hand. This has the potential to streamline ultrasound appointments as a point-of-care option that allows immediate scans and diagnostics.See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
En este episodio, entrevisto a Pablo Herrero Gallego, fisioterapeuta, Doctor en Fisioterapia por la Universidad de Zaragoza y profesor e investigador en la Unizar. Es Presidente de la Asociación para la Investigación en la Discapacidad Motriz (AIDIMO) y Editor de la Revista Fisioterapia Invasiva y Journal of Invasive Techniques in Physical Therapy. Entre los logros científicos destacan diferentes publicaciones en revistas de impacto internacional en el área de fisioterapia invasiva y dolor, destacando además ser el autor de la técnica y concepto DNHS®. Le entrevisto para hablar sobre su trayectoria con la punción seca, revisar sus fundamentos, aplicaciones específicas y otros aspectos relacionados Referencias recomendadas: (1) Brandín-de la Cruz N, Calvo S, Rodríguez-Blanco C, Herrero P, Bravo-Esteban E. The Phase One IQ3 Monochrome back is one of the most exciting things to happen in camera design in the age of digital photography. The sensor weighs in at a cool 101 Megapixels and its designed to capture light past the visual spectrum. When you understand how to shape this using filters you have one of the most advanced, digital monochrome cameras ever made. The results are stunning.
